In Athens, the average high winter temperature is 15 °C while the average low is 10 °C. Rainfall is also common, but they are usually short. The upper mountain regions of Greece are cold and see heavy snowfall during winter. The Greek islands are also cold and windy. In Corfu, for example, the average temperatures range between 7 …

The climate of Greece, a country in south-eastern Europe, is Mediterranean on coasts and islands, with mild, rainy winters and hot, sunny summers. The northern cities, located in the inland areas of Epirus, Macedonia and Thessaly, have a slightly continental climate, with quite cold winters, during which air masses coming from the north can sometimes bring snow and frost, and hot summers ...
